Description: The author of the groundbreaking bestseller "How to Think Like a Horse" continues her exploration of how horses learn with a focus on the knowledge every horse needs to live safely and confidently in the company of people. Full color.

Cherry Hill is an internationally known instructor and horse trainer and has written numerous books, including 101 Arena Exercises for Horse & Rider, Horsekeeping on a Small Acreage, How to Think Like a Horse, What Every Horse Should Know, and Horse Care for Kids.
